Yes, pets weighing less than 20 kg are allowed on board.
Yes, you can bring your own food and drinks. Lunch is not included. Please note that in October and November, you will have to bring your own picnic as the restaurants in Girolata are closed.
Hotel pickup is not available. The meeting point is at the port of Cargèse, which has a free car park nearby.
The total duration of the boat trip is 6 hours and 15 minutes.
Yes, a short swimming stop is planned in the Calanques de Piana, depending on the weather conditions.
The trip includes a visit to the Scandola Nature Reserve, Capo Rosso and its caves, and the Calanques de Piana. There is also a 2-hour stop in the village of Girolata.
No, lunch is not included. You will have a 2-hour break in Girolata where you can eat at a restaurant or have a picnic. Please be aware that restaurants are closed in October and November.
Yes, there is a free car park available for you near the port of Cargèse.
